Ультразвуковий датчик HC-SR04 - це стабільний та точний ultrasonic sonar (сонар) датчик відстані який не має "сліпих зон". Може вимірювати відстань від 0 см до 1500мм, точність досягає 3 мм.
Характеристики
-
Робоча напруга: 3.8 - 5.5В
-
Тип: HC-SR04
-
Струм: 8 мА
-
Частота: 40 кГц
-
Максимальна дистанція: 1500 мм
-
Мінімальна дистанція: 0 см
-
Роздільна здатність: 3 мм
-
Ширина імпульсів: 10 мкс
-
Кут: 15 градусів
-
Зовнішні габарити: 37x20x15 мм
Рекомендуємо додатково придбати кронштейн для кріплення.
Принцип роботи
1. На вихід trig (тригер) посилаємо високий рівень протягом як мінімум 10мкс
2. Модуль починає посилати ультразвукові імпульси з частотою 40 кГц і приймає їх назад, якщо в зоні видимості є будь-які перешкоди
3. Якщо сигнал повертається, модуль встановлює низький рівень на виході echo на 150мс. За часом, який минув з п.1 до низького рівня на виході echo можна розрахувати відстань до перешкоди за формулою:
Відстань = (time * sound velocity)/2
де time - виміряний час імпульсу, sound velocity - швидкість звуку (340 м/с)
Статті
Вячеслав (02.09.2019)
Датчик оказался идеальным для использования в моем проекте. Конкурентом ему по надежности из опробованных мной ("детекторов препятствия", призванных надежно определять покупателя перед прилавком) был только лазерный детектор препятствия от Waveshare, но в моем случае лазерное пятно на одежде у людей могло вызвать неправильные ассоциации ;), а ультрозвуковой дальномер оказался удобней не только своей "незаметностью", но и гибкостью настройки, позволяющей точно выставить расстояние, с которого должно происходить обнаружение покупателя. Замечательно подцепился к модулю ESP-01S.
Ответить
Влад (06.05.2017)
Днепр, по поводу доставки - 2 дня. После оформления заказа сразу позвонили и в тот же день отправили.
Сам датчик на расстоянии 150 см реагирует на провод диаметром 1,5 мм. (В единицах измерения не перепутал ничего, именно мм).
Определяет расстояние довольно точно, могу сказать, что на расстояние 2 м спокойно реагирует на провод диаметром 1,5 мм. Дальше я не проверял.
Спасибо за быстрое и качественное обслуживание.
Ответить
Вішко Тарас Ярославович (20.04.2017)
Отличный датчик . Все заявленные характеристики соответствуют. Для тех кто использует рядом два и более датчика , предлагаю включать их по очереди с разрывом хотя бы 50мсек. , а то я чуть не забраковал их ))) , первый работал на отлично , а остальные сильно врали . Оказалось они принимали сигнал предыдущих .
Ответить
Сергій (13.05.2016)
У квітні робили замовлення компонентів для переможців Всеукраїнської олімпіади з електроніки. Серед іншого замовили Ультразвуковой датчик расстояния HC-SR04.
Дякуємо ARDUINO-UA.COM за якісну організацію роботи, оперативне уточнення деталей замовлення та швидку доставку компонентів - фактично за 1,5 доби, це для нас було дуже важливо.
Окрема подяка за зроблену для університету знижку!
Студенти, що користуються компонентами, задоволені.
З повагою,
Оргкомітет Всеукраїнської студентської олімпіади з електроніки http://inel.stu.cn.ua/olympiad/
Чернігівський національний технологічний університет http://stu.cn.ua/
Ответить
Robostar (30.08.2015)
скетч попроще
ширина импульса pulseIn(EchoPin, HIGH)
ширина импульса(мкс)/58= дистанция (см)
ширина импульса(мкс)/148= дистанция (дюйм)
--------------------------------------------------------------------
#define TrigPin 8 //пин для выхода trig
#define EchoPin 9 //пин для выхода echo
long distance;
void setup()
{
Serial.begin(9600);
pinMode(EchoPin, INPUT);
pinMode(TrigPin, OUTPUT);
digitalWrite(TrigPin, LOW);
}
void loop()
{
digitalWrite(TrigPin, HIGH);
delayMicroseconds(10);
digitalWrite(TrigPin, LOW);
distance = pulseIn(EchoPin, HIGH)/58;
Serial.println(distance);
}
Ответить
Олег (17.09.2013)
норм датчик, только следует учитывать что если обьект находится далеко то мелкие обьекты оно обнаруживать будет плохо, только крупные, а так норм, руку до 30-40 см видит, а большую книжку по размерам как А4 до 70-80см, в принципе более чем достаточно что бы робот уверено ориентировался в пространстве и изучал территорию. правда попался мне сначала бракованный, а когда захотел поменять то был приятно удивлен тем что мне без проблем и лишних вопросов поменяли датчик на рабочий, за что отдельное спасибо)
Ответить